  • The New York Times-bestselling author begins a gripping new saga about a refugee from the future come to save the Earth and the one naval space officer who believes her. When the destruction of Earth causes a time rift, one ship is thrust back in time to decades prior. The semi-disgraced naval officer Kayl Owen is sent from the Earth Guard ship Vigilant to investigate. He finds one person alive, one person whose DNA analysis reveals to have some non-human DNA, a person who his superiors say isn't human. That's not how Kayl Owen sees it. He thinks Lieutenant Genji of the near future Unified Fleet - the future successor of Earth Guard - is every bit a person. And more, the knowledge she brings from the future might hold the key to saving Earth from destruction. Owen, Genji and everything they know is deeply threatening to a lot of people, and the two of them need to survive each day to get to the next and save the future for everyone. But will changing Earth's future erase Genji?
